Non-GMO Certification Requirements for Food Manufacturers
CGA’s Non-GMO Standard is designed to protect consumers and support manufacturers that want to produce transparent, trustworthy products. To comply, you must demonstrate full system control from sourcing to storage to final packaging.
The requirements are clear, practical, and built to make your Non-GMO program strong and reliable.
| Category | Requirements | ||
| Ingredient Sourcing | Approved suppliers, identity-preserved materials, affidavits, and clean documentation from every source. | ||
| GMO Risk Assessment | A full assessment covering raw materials, equipment, environment, and all possible GMO-risk points. | ||
| Facility Controls | Segregated areas, validated sanitation, allergen planning, and dedicated or verified non-GMO production lines. | ||
| Traceability & Mass Balance | Lot tracking, mass-balance checks, and annual mock recalls to confirm that product flow matches documentation. | ||
| Testing & Verification | PCR, rapid strip, or ingredient testing when required, following CGA-approved testing frequency. | ||
| Production & Handling | SOPs for receiving, batching, processing, and packaging to prevent cross-contact. | ||
| Labeling & Claims | Clean, accurate, verified Non-GMO labels with no unsupported claims. | ||
| Staff Training | Regular training for procurement, QA, operators, and production teams. | ||
| Continuous Improvement | KPIs, management review, and corrective action planning to maintain a strong system. | ||
| Audit & Verification | CGA’s independent audit confirms compliance across your entire supply chain and facility. |
These requirements give retailers, regulators, and consumers the confidence that your product is truly Non-GMO from start to finish.
Non-GMO Certification Process
CGA follows a clear, structured certification process that ensures transparency and reliability at every stage:
- Application Submission – Submit your basic company and product details. CGA provides all required forms.
- Documentation Review – Review of supplier files, ingredient lists, affidavits, risk assessment, testing plans, and traceability documentation.
- On-Site Audit – A CGA auditor verifies segregation, mass-balance, SOPs, testing, facility controls, training, and labeling systems.
- Corrective Actions (If Needed) – If gaps appear, CGA issues a corrective plan. Most manufacturers close gaps quickly without needing a re-audit.
- Certification Approval – Once all requirements are met, your facility receives official Non-GMO Certification valid for 12 months.
This process gives you a fully verified Non-GMO claim backed by independent, globally recognized auditing.
